
第10章 框架和导航结构的设计 在Autuorware中,利用“框架”图标,可以建立流程的页,通过“导航”图标,可以实 现对页的访问。 10.1翻页结构设计一西风吹书读哪页 10.1.1认识框架图标 在如hore中,框架结构有三部分组成:据架图标回 不同生页的页图标、了导 航图标。在框架图标中他们三者只有结合在一起才有导航的作用: 框架图标 [Untried] 回刻 Level 1 框死 框架中的页 图101配架图标 可☒ Etry:Lomel 1 Ge back 程Ctp星 Re3 tfraaewor含 Firet Page Erit:Level I 图102框架露标的内多姑构 “框架”图标窗口共分为三部分。 在输入窗口的最顶端是一个“显示”图标。 “显示”图标的下方是“交互”图标
1 第 10 章 框架和导航结构的设计 在 Autuorware 中,利用“框架”图标,可以建立流程的页,通过“导航”图标,可以实 现对页的访问。 10.1 翻页结构设计——西风吹书读哪页 10.1.1 认识框架图标 在 Authorware 中,框架结构有三部分组成:框架图标 、不同主页的页图标、 导 航图标。在框架图标中他们三者只有结合在一起才有导航的作用。 图 10.1 框架图标 图 10.2 框架图标的内部结构 “框架”图标窗口共分为三部分。 在输入窗口的最顶端是一个“显示”图标。 “显示”图标的下方是“交互”图标

说刺领儿页 楼超 查执按组 出 第一 下面 前一贾 校恒 面1Q3导前按恒 在“交互”图标中的八个定向按钮,在程序运行时,具要单击这些定向按钮境可以实现 页面的赋转和查找。 已。--中国资狼苑 回刻 Level I i 中国奇现 山山 由由由图卤 阿中细音狼 回× a高Gray Navigstion Pael Entry:Level I Navigat ion hoyp... Go back Recent pa鲜经 Find Exit franevork IIII I F1F生P电 Exit:Levrel 图04例10-1-中国向观程序 运行该程序后屏幕上首先出观图0.5的效果,然后可点击屏幕上的按细,程序将会按照 图10.3所示的响应方式跳转。 2
2 图 10.3 导航按钮 在“交互”图标中的八个定向按钮,在程序运行时,只要单击这些定向按钮就可以实现 页面的跳转和查找。 图 10.4 例 10-1-中国奇观程序 运行该程序后屏幕上首先出现图 10.5 的效果,然后可点击屏幕上的按钮,程序将会按照 图 10.3 所示的响应方式跳转

Prevertation Window 中国奇观 的的 购空中刘 图10.5例10-1-中国奇我程序运行效果 10.1,2认识导航图标 “导航”图标主要用于控制程序的芪转方白和方式,通过该图标。可践转到程序中任意 “框架”图标下的页图标。 具体可实现以下功能: (1)跳转到程序中任意页图标: (2)图标间的相对位置跳转,如魔转到前一到成后一页1 (③)回到用户使用过的页图标: ()在用户己使用过的真图标中选择一页作为目的页: (5)查找功能定位所需的页图标并珠转: (通过于程序调用珠转并返回。 “框架”图标建立了到的站构。但要实现与页之间的定向链接,就是用“导航”图标, 双击“导航”图标,打开“Properties Navigate Icon(Recent pages”属性设置对话框。 4<1附8 ed-2004-4 图1收6导机图标属性设置 在对话框的“Destina磁ion”栏中可选择如下五种链接方式. 3
3 图 10.5 例 10-1-中国奇观程序运行效果 10.1.2 认识导航图标 “导航”图标主要用于控制程序的跳转方向和方式,通过该图标,可跳转到程序中任意 “框架”图标下的页图标。 具体可实现以下功能: (1)跳转到程序中任意页图标; (2)图标间的相对位置跳转,如跳转到前一页或后一页; (3)回到用户使用过的页图标; (4)在用户已使用过的页图标中选择一页作为目的页; (5)查找功能定位所需的页图标并跳转; (6)通过于程序调用跳转并返回。 “框架”图标建立了页的结构,但要实现与页之间的定向链接,就是用“导航”图标。 双击“导航”图标,打开“Properties:Navigate Icon[Recent pages] ”属性设置对话框。 图 10.6 导航图标属性设置 在对话框的“Destination”栏中可选择如下五种链接方式

1.Recent 2.Nearby 即路行 Becmt papis 511登 -46 E4合h4同E Bef.bplo CBat Cfirst CLat 反 Bei Pruterurk/betws 图107设置最近真面属性 1)单击“Prei0us”按钮 2)单击“Ne国”核细 3)单击“Fi国”按钮 4)单击"L。”按钮 S)单击“ExitFramework/Return”按细 3.Anywhere 分 习 511s位 An 4d8004 Tof.bodke m“出 ☒ 相■女 Etire fle ☒青河海有 同 T.a ☒香现痛现 可 ☒万里长城 图10.8设置任意位置风商属性 4.Calculate Sacimt papis 1 ion:Caleul的。 t Tata 反 图10.9设置计算页面属性 5.Search 即送 Sacwt papia ntisution:Fwd 1300446 m*氏2rt 反 密1Q10设置查找页面属性 "Type
4 1.Recent 2.Nearby 图 10.7 设置最近页面属性 1)单击“Previous”按钮 2)单击“Next”按钮 3)单击“First”按钮 4)单击“Last”按钮 5)单击“ExitFramework/Return”按钮 3.Anywhere 图 10.8 设置任意位置页面属性 4.Calculate 图 10.9 设置计算页面属性 5.Search 图 10.10 设置查找页面属性 “Type

"Search”(搜素) 10.1,3创建框架结构的基本操作 框架结构的创建一般步骤如下: (1)指曳“框架”图标到主流程线上并角名。 (2)拖曳页图标至“框架”图标的右侧释放并命名。 (双击“框架”图标打开其“输入/输出”层进行编辑。输入/输出层的结构道程及缺省 工具条 (4)编辑“柜架”图标右侧各页的内容 框架输入层有一套缺省的阻页工具条。共有8个按组,如果对缺省的阻页工具条不满意, 例知工具条按细个数、核组形状、按钮位置以及各按钮的响应方式等,均可以进行调整,具 体操作如下。 ()改变工具条的按钮数目: (2)政变响应方式: (3)政变按钮形状: (4)指放按钮位置: 当程序执行到一个框架结构时,在进入其中第一个页图标前首先执行“框架”图标的输 入层内容,在窗口中显示出输入层缺省的(成定制的)导航按钮,然后自动遗入首页浏览。 在退出框架结构时,执行框架输出层的设置内容后,刷除框架结构中的所有内容,撒销所有 导航控制: 另外,替换系统默认的定向控制还有另一种方法,那就是使用核块进行替换。 如果确实想这样做,可以参無下面的具体步裸进行: L.打开uthorware7的文作夹,在列表框中用鼠标右键单击Framowrk..7d文件,选择“剪切” 金令。然后进入其他目录,用右键单击窗口的空白处,在弹出的菜单中选择“粘贴”命令, 将此模块文件移动到这个文件夹中保存。 2,打开流程线上的“掘架”图标,然后副除输入窗口中的所有图标,按用户的需要设置新的 定向控制结构。 [实例10.1】西风吹书读哪页一中国奇观电子图书 程序设计的步露如下: 1,用“dify”→“File”→“Properties”命令设置程序的基本参数,途定分裤率为 640X490. 2。燕业一个根架图标回至流程找上,松后为它命名“中国奇限 3.先后施曳七个显示图标到框架图标的右下方建立七条分支,然后分别为它命名为“背 量”,“喜玛亚拉山”,“黄河瀑布”、,“万里长规”,“西安兵马佰”、“新安江”、“青藏高源”。 4。双击“背景”显示图标,用文本设计标愿“中国奇观”,然后输入“第十章框架和导 航结构的设计/101-翻页结构设计/10-1-中国奇观图片/背景.g”。 5.依次双击后面的暴示图标,然后分别输入“第十章框架和导航结构的设计/101-翻页 结构设计/101-中国奇观图片/”相应的图片
5 “Search”(搜索) 10.1.3 创建框架结构的基本操作 框架结构的创建一般步骤如下: (1)拖曳“框架”图标到主流程线上并命名。 (2)拖曳页图标至“框架”图标的右侧释放并命名。 (3)双击“框架”图标打开其“输入/输出”层进行编辑。输入/输出层的结构流程及缺省 工具条。 (4)编辑“框架”图标右侧各页的内容 框架输入层有一套缺省的翻页工具条,共有 8 个按钮,如果对缺省的翻页工具条不满意, 例如工具条按钮个数、按钮形状、按钮位置以及各按钮的响应方式等,均可以进行调整,具 体操作如下。 (1)改变工具条的按钮数目: (2)改变响应方式: (3)改变按钮形状: (4)拖放按钮位置: 当程序执行到一个框架结构时,在进入其中第—个页图标前首先执行“框架”图标的输 入层内容,在窗口中显示出输入层缺省的(或定制的)导航按钮,然后自动进入首页浏览。 在退出框架结构时,执行框架输出层的设置内容后,删除框架结构中的所有内容,撤销所有 导航控制。 另外,替换系统默认的定向控制还有另一种方法,那就是使用模块进行替换。 如果确实想这样做,可以参照下面的具体步骤进行: 1.打开 Authorware7 的文件夹,在列表框中用鼠标右键单击 Framewrk.a7d 文件,选择“剪切” 命令。然后进入其他目录,用右键单击窗口的空白处,在弹出的菜单中选择“粘贴”命令, 将此模块文件移动到这个文件夹中保存。 2.打开流程线上的“框架”图标,然后删除输入窗口中的所有图标,按用户的需要设置新的 定向控制结构。 [实例 10.1] 西风吹书读哪页--中国奇观电子图书 程序设计的步骤如下: 1.用“Modify”→“File”→“Properties”命令设置程序的基本参数,选定分辨率为 640×480。 2.拖曳一个框架图标 至流程线上,然后为它命名“中国奇观”。 3.先后拖曳七个显示图标到框架图标的右下方建立七条分支,然后分别为它命名为“背 景”、“喜玛亚拉山”、“黄河瀑布”、“万里长城”、“西安兵马俑”、“新安江”、“青藏高原”。 4.双击“背景” 显示图标,用文本设计标题“中国奇观”,然后输入“第十章框架和导 航结构的设计/10-1-翻页结构设计/10-1-中国奇观图片/背景.jpg”。 5.依次双击后面的显示图标,然后分别输入“第十章框架和导航结构的设计/10-1-翻页 结构设计/10-1-中国奇观图片/”相应的图片

10.2动态跳转设计—非线性阅读 10.2.1几种常见的翻页跳转结构 在Auaw心中,有关翻页结构的制作在很大程度上都活要通过“导航”图标及“概架” 图标协作来完成,两者缺一不可。 一、在多个框架图标之间实现跌转 . Leel 1 品 智品 sperties sigate bron IGo k] 打插 Aaprhaos 304-4 mgu细 1 Eutiee fule 回 同 Eywrd 回4 图101山多个框架函标之间的联转 二、利用导航图标直接转 . 华 Lewe2 1 智品 为一减e鞋和是 n隔0 14 名数 1d2044-d me“ 有地nwk Bvtire fhie Eowed 周10.12直接跳转 三、使用交互图标控制践转
6 10.2 动态跳转设计——非线性阅读 10.2.1 几种常见的翻页跳转结构 在 Autuorware 中,有关翻页结构的制作在很大程度上都需要通过“导航”图标及“框架” 图标协作来完成,两者缺一不可。 一、在多个框架图标之间实现跳转 图 10.11 多个框架图标之间的跳转 二、利用导航图标直接跳转 图 10.12 直接跳转 三、使用交互图标控制跳转

E[Un诚ed -回x Level 1 选择 热对费 Unlinked 只西 3 图10,13交互控制 10.2.2框架的嵌套和返回 框架的帐套是指一个框架的某些页中还存在有另外一个框架的使用方式。 【实例10.2]多煤体教材 程序设计的步露如下: 1,设置程序的基本参数。 2,指曳一个交互图标至流程线上,然后为它命名“多媒体教材”。包括四个按钮响应,: 四多煤体数材a7p 回x Level 1 多煤体教材 讲授内容 问题分析 帮助 图10.14多煤体校材主程序 3.为每一按钮响应设置链接。 回多媒体数材.。7和 回 Level 1 多媒体教材 讲授内容 可题分析 L-L 帮助 多煤体教材内容 回 授内容 面面面面 帮助
7 图 10.13 交互控制 10.2.2 框架的嵌套和返回 框架的嵌套是指一个框架的某些页中还存在有另外一个框架的使用方式。 [实例 10.2] 多媒体教材 程序设计的步骤如下: 1.设置程序的基本参数。 2.拖曳一个交互图标至流程线上,然后为它命名“多媒体教材”。包括四个按钮响应,。 图 10.14 多媒体教材主程序 3.为每一按钮响应设置链接

图1015多置体教材楂恒响成登置 4.总体框架中的“习题”部分内容应该包含各章的习题。所以在“习题”这一夜中又色 含了一个名为“章”的子框架,此子框架中的每一页相当于每一张的习思。 问多提体意材7p -回 Level 1 多棋体教材 问题分析 多煤体教材内容 回 内 配数 回 Level 2 图形 响向向响向 图10.16多煤体教材子框紫示意周 回多紫体教材a7和 回x Level 1 多爆体教材 讲授内客 3 问通分析 助 多煤体款材内容 散内容 面面面面 图1017多规体数材程序跳转 当从主框某中进入其中一页的子框架时,程序并不退出主框架。 柜架的嵌套中队认的导航控制功能与普通柜架中默认的控制响应按耀的功能区别, 在医架帐套中的搜索功能。 Anywhere和Calculated类型的导航控制特点. 利用导航图标实现主框架和子框架中的相互典转。 二、框架的返回 框架的返日与前雨介绍的廷回并不相同,前面介绍的内容是设置如何返国到最近访月的 某页,而框某的返回相当于程序设计语言中的子程序概念。 要创建一个完整的子程序,操作步骤如下: (1》施动一个粗架图标到流程线上, (2》施动其他图标到框架图标的右边,并编这些图标的内容。 (3)在柜架图标的每一页的最后都添如一个导航图标,并将其属性设置为Naby中的Exit
8 图 10.15 多媒体教材按钮响应设置 4.总体框架中的“习题”部分内容应该包含各章的习题,所以在“习题”这一夜中又包 含了一个名为“章”的子框架,此子框架中的每一页相当于每一张的习题。 图 10.16 多媒体教材子框架示意图 图 10.17 多媒体教材程序跳转 当从主框架中进入其中一页的子框架时,程序并不退出主框架。 框架的嵌套中默认的导航控制功能与普通框架中默认的控制响应按钮的功能区别。 在框架嵌套中的搜索功能。 Anywhere 和 Calculated 类型的导航控制特点。 利用导航图标实现主框架和子框架中的相互跳转。 二、框架的返回 框架的返回与前面介绍的返回并不相同,前面介绍的内容是设置如何返回到最近访问的 某页,而框架的返回相当于程序设计语言中的子程序概念。 要创建一个完整的子程序,操作步骤如下: (1) 拖动一个框架图标到流程线上。 (2) 拖动其他图标到框架图标的右边,并编辑这些图标的内容。 (3) 在框架图标的每一页的最后都添加一个导航图标,并将其属性设置为Nearby中的Exit

Framework/Return. (4)燕动一个导航图标到程序中需要跳转的地方。 (S)导航图标属性对话框中将该号航图标的Destination属性设置成Amywhere. (6)在A吗where属性下面的ype选项组中选择Call and Return单达按钮. (7) 桂接到子程序中的某一页。 (8) 重复步骤(4》到步骤(7)的操作,直到结束。 10.3热字链接—超文本大动员 在Autuorware中,利用超文本对象也可以建立一种定向情接。当使用鼠标单击、双击或 将碱标移至定义的超文本正文对象上时,Auu4e就会直接进入与该正文对象所对应、所 链接的页中,这样的正文对象被我们称之为超文本对象。简称超文本。 10.3.1超级链接文本使用原则 10.3.2设置超级链接文本的风格 超级链接文本都是具备一定风格的。在Autuorware中,超级链接把定义一种风格和导航 图标建立的文互结合在一起使用。 Define Sty回 nefaclt Stple) PSmt网 Fo可 Sample 厂lw 厂td 1ntsr银t4lty 厂hle1tt 管a: r有m,月 厂or行pt 广T11年月1 TexE Cut. 广mt国 F的.间.T开Tast.- 厂nted1i西 厂C正r0 D118y1) Wodtfy Mdd Fmgvr 图0,18定义超文本链接的最示风格 1.Interactivity 2.Auto Highlight 3.Cursor 4.Navigate To
9 Framework/Return。 (4) 拖动一个导航图标到程序中需要跳转的地方。 (5) 导航图标属性对话框中将该导航图标的 Destination 属性设置成 Anywhere。 (6) 在 Anywhere 属性下面的 Type 选项组中选择 Call and Return 单选按钮。 (7) 链接到子程序中的某一页。 (8) 重复步骤(4)到步骤(7)的操作,直到结束。 10.3 热字链接——超文本大动员 在 Autuorware 中,利用超文本对象也可以建立一种定向链接,当使用鼠标单击、双击或 将鼠标移至定义的超文本正文对象上时,Autuorware 就会直接进入与该正文对象所对应、所 链接的页中,这样的正文对象被我们称之为超文本对象,简称超文本。 10.3.1 超级链接文本使用原则 10.3.2 设置超级链接文本的风格 超级链接文本都是具备一定风格的。在 Autuorware 中,超级链接把定义一种风格和导航 图标建立的交互结合在一起使用。 图 10.18 定义超文本链接的显示风格 1. Interactivity 2. Auto Highlight 3. Cursor 4. Navigate To

10.3.3设置超级链接文本的基本操作 在Auwe中制作超文本要用到的Define Styles对话框, (1》施动一一个据果图标到流程线上,命名为“主菜单,双击打开该框架图标。将其所有 内容酬除拖动四个显示图标放在框架图标的右边,分别命名村本书目录”、“唐诗“、 “宋词,“古风 回超性接染单.7p 回 Level 1 主票单 本书目柔 图1019相饭线接程序 (2) 单击Text菜单,选释Define Styles选项. (3) 双击“本书目录”显示图标,其中“唐诗”、“宋词,“古风”全部设为“标题”风格。 本 目 图10.20切级销接的计面 (4)双击“唐诗”显示图标,其中“返目”设为“返日风格。 10
10 10.3.3 设置超级链接文本的基本操作 在 Autuorware 中制作超文本要用到的 Define Styles 对话框。 (1) 拖动一个框架图标到流程线上,命名为“主菜单”,双击打开该框架图标,将其所有 内容删除。拖动四个显示图标放在框架图标的右边,分别命名为“本书目录”、“唐诗”、 “宋词”、“古风”。 图 10.19 超级链接程序 (2) 单击 Text 菜单,选择 Define Styles 选项。 (3) 双击“本书目录”显示图标,其中“唐诗”、“宋词”、“古风”全部设为“标题”风格。 图 10.20 超级链接的封面 (4) 双击“唐诗”显示图标,其中“返回”设为“返回”风格